After the Ohio State Buckeyes signed Kansas State Wildcats transfer quarterback Will Howard out of the transfer portal this offseason, many fans expected quarterback Devin Brown to hit the transfer portal. But not only is he staying to compete for the starting job with Howard, but it sounds like he impressed his coach on the first day of spring practice.
Devin Brown took the reps with the first-team offense during Ohio State’s first spring practice of the year on Thursday, and it sounds like head coach Ryan Day was pleased by what he saw from his quarterback.
“I was impressed with how he practiced today,” Ryan Day said. “He had a good demeanor. He had that same conviction out at practice that he shared with you guys the past couple of days. So, if he keeps building like that, I mean he’s gonna have a hell of a spring.”
During his press conference earlier this week, Brown made it very clear that he had no intention of transferring and was “here to compete no matter what.”
Based on the way he performed in practice this week, it sounds like that is definitely the case and he has a real chance of winning the starting job even with Howard joining the roster.
